Guinea - Import of Pliers, Pincers, Tweezers and Similar Tools
In 2015, the country was number 140 comparing other countries in Import of Pliers, Pincers, Tweezers and Similar Tools at $103,374. Guinea is overtaken by Bahamas, which was ranked number 139 with $103,536 and is followed by Aruba at $98,261.76. United States lead the ranking with $276,300,338.61 in 2019, a decrease of 1% compared to 2018. Germany, France and Netherlands resp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Central African Republic witnessed the best average annual growth at +164.8% per year, while Togo was the worst growing country at -41.7% per year.
